Anemia is the world’s most common nutritional disorder, affecting more than 1 billion people. Although anemia can affect anyone, the majority of those are women of childbearing age and young children.
Anemia is an excessively low concentration of hemoglobin in the blood, it occurs either when there are too few red blood cells, and their oxygen-carrying capacity is compromised.
It can be caused by a deficiency of essential nutrients, such as folate or vitamin B12; in this case, anemia is characterized by larger-than-normal red blood cells.
Folate plays a vital role in many bodily processes, such as creating red blood cells.
